Acute myocardial infarction is an event in which a series of changes occur in the heart tissue, caused by the obstruction of a coronary artery or decreased blood flow, causing low oxygen supply in the cardiac cell, culminating in cell death and loss of heart tissue.
Each year, more than a million Americans have a heart attack also known as an acute myocardial infarction, or AMI.
Acute MI includes both non-ST-segment-elevation myocardial infarction (NSTEMI) and ST-segment-elevation myocardial infarction (STEMI). Distinction between NSTEMI and STEMI is vital as treatment strategies are different for these two entities.

A heart attack is also known as a myocardial infarction.The three types of heart attacks are: ST segment elevation myocardial infarction (STEMI) non-ST segment elevation myocardial infarction (NSTEMI) coronary spasm, or unstable angina.
What are the symptoms of heart attack? Chest pain or discomfort. Feeling weak, light-headed, or faint. Pain or discomfort in the jaw, neck, or back. Pain or discomfort in one or both arms or shoulders. Shortness of breath.
An ST-elevation myocardial infarction (STEMI) is a type of heart attack that mainly affects your hearts lower chambers. They are named for how they change the appearance of your hearts electrical activity on a certain type of diagnostic test.
Acute Myocardial Infarction (heart attack) Acute myocardial infarction, also known as a heart attack, is a life-threatening condition that occurs when blood flow to the heart muscle is abruptly cut off, causing tissue damage. This is usually the result of a blockage in one or more of the coronary arteries.
